In a culture where divorce, disconnection, and narcissistic behavior seem to be everywhere, how do we reclaim God’s design for marriage? In this packed and powerful episode of the *Christian Readers Community Podcast*, I sit down with **Dana Nygaard**—Licensed Professional Counselor, speaker, and author of *365 Dates to Renew Your Christian Marriage*. But this conversation goes far beyond her book. Dana and I dive deep into the real-life struggles many couples face today—broken communication, emotional wounds, the rise of narcissism in relationships, and the spiritual battle over the covenant of marriage. With wisdom grounded in faith, psychology, and years of counseling experience, Dana shares practical tools and Spirit-led insight to help couples rebuild connection, trust, and joy. Whether you're married, preparing for marriage, or walking through a season of healing, this episode offers both encouragement and challenge. And as the host, I’ll be honest—I walked away changed. **Listen now, There’s so much to unpack in this one—you don’t want to miss it.** --- **About the Guest:** **Dana Nygaard** is a Licensed Professional Counselor, speaker, and relationship expert who transforms the lives of single Catholic women through her *Miss to Mrs. – From Single to Sacramental* program. She blends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Attachment Theory, and Catholic spirituality to help women build faith-centered relationships. As the author of *365 Dates to Renew Your Christian Marriage (Catholic Edition)* and founder of the *Cana Commandments Marriage Retreat*, Dana equips individuals and couples with tools to foster resilient, joyful, and lasting relationships rooted in faith and love.
